    Former child star Dollars (Lucas Till) and Martine turned fitness infomercial star The Lobo (Jason Trost, who directed and wrote this) are about to make the new season of their reality show, Pussy Police, in Thailand. They have a new member in their crew, Turbo (Scout Taylor-Compton, once Laurie Strode), who may seem innocent but who may be able to drink and drug both of them into a coma.

    The truth is that the network is sick of their egos and demands, so they strand them in Thailand in the hopes that they won't make it back for the actual new season. Also: Lobo has a treasure map from his father which he hopes will lead them to enough jewels to get them back to the U. S. and their show.

    I'd love to know where the true story part of this comes in. That said, it's a fun one, as you go from laughing at these two party guys into learning their insecurities and why they act this way before starting to root for them. It takes a lot of talent to find the brains and emotion in a movie about partying until you throw up, then drink a beer, then throw up again.
